The original cost for a distillation tower is $24,000 and the useful life of the tower is estimated to be 8 years. The sinking-fund method for determining the rate of depreciation is used (see Example 5), and the effective annual interest rate for the depreciation fund is 6 percent. If the scrap value of the distillation tower is $4000, determine the asset value (i.e., total book value of equipment) at the end of 5 years.

Estimation of filtering area required for a plate-and-frame filtration operation. A plate-and-frame filter press is to be used for removing the solid material from a slurry containing 5 lb of dry solids per cubic foot of solid-free liquid. The viscosity of the liquid is 1 centipoise, and the filter must deliver at least 400 ft3 of solid-free filtrate over a continuous operating time of 2 h when the pressure-difference driving force over the filter unit is constant at 25 psi. On the basis of the following data obtained in a small plate-and-frame filter press, estimate the total area of filtering surface required.
Experimental data: The following data were obtained in a plate-and-frame filter press with a total filtering area of 8 ft2:
